Using A Multimeter To Test A Fuel Pressure Sensor
Step 1
Before beginning the process, you must disconnect the fuel pressure sensor. Usually, they are connected using an electrical harness.
Open the hood of your car and look for the pressure sensor; then, unplug it carefully and make sure you don’t accidentally disconnect anything else near the engine of the vehicle.
If you can’t find the harness, check your car’s manual for further instructions. You’ll be looking for a conglomeration of cables connecting into a single location.
Step 2
With the fuel sensor disconnected, turn on your car’s engine and get a hold of your multimeter. Do not close your car’s hood during any of these steps.
Step 3
Use your multimeter to check for the voltage of the harness’ connections. The multimeter should prompt you with an array of different values.
To know which of these values are right and which of these are wrong, you’ll have to check your car’s manual and identify the ideal voltage of the vehicle.
Step 4
Once you’ve found the right values for your car in the manual, compare them to those being shown by your multimeter. If the values are wrong, you might have to replace the entire fuel pressure sensor.
In this case, check with a trusted technician before getting rid of yours.
Step 5
If the values are not wrong, you might have to change or properly plug the wires of your car. There might be a wire malfunction, or they could’ve been wrongly connected.
This is also one of the main causes of bad pressure tank symptoms, and they’re rather easily fixed.
Step 6
If you’re going to check the wiring connections of your car, be sure to use a specialized test box.
If you’re using the one included with your car (or the same test box recommended by your car’s manufacturer), the testing process will be very straightforward. If not, you’re going to have to set the values manually.
We strongly suggest you use the test box provided by the manufacturer. If you don’t have one, pay a visit to a manufacturer-approved expert and ask them about it.
